Description Petr Pisar 2019-07-08 07:48:46 UTC
commit 2b3fa8bef4f6eb068c04e1c25a4b59301603fa24
Author: Boris Ranto <branto>
Date:   Tue Dec 4 22:24:42 2018 +0100

    New release (2:14.0.1-1)
    
    - sync with upstream
    - drop 32-bit support, it is no longer supported upstream

Comment 1 Boris Ranto 2019-07-09 15:17:48 UTC
Sadly, this is on purpose. We are getting to a point when we are running out of address space (i.e. 3GB on 32-bit arches) when compiling Ceph. Also, we are talking single threaded compilation. It was not possible to use multiple threads to compile Ceph for quite a while. Upstream has dropped the support for 32-bit arches a long time ago.
